Weekend Senior Sales Associate

Weekend Senior Sales Associate

2nd Swing Golf

Columbia, MD

$25 - $35/hr

Part-time

Medical, Retirement, PTO

Posted 17 days ago


Job description

As a Weekend Senior Sales Associate at 2nd Swing, you’ll use your in-depth golf experience and equipment knowledge to help guests find the right clubs, understand our selection, and feel confident in their golf game. This role is ideal for someone who has extensive experience and passionate about the game. You’ll engage with customers on the sales floor, provide informed recommendations, and create a welcoming, high-quality experience customer experience. A background in golf, strong product knowledge, and ability to connect with players at every skill level will make you a trusted resource for our weekend customers. Weekend availability is required.

Position Responsibilities:
 
  • 10+ years extensive experience in golf sales or fitting
  • A dedication to creating exceptional customer experiences
  • A passion for golf
  • Weekend availability

    Required Qualifications:  

    • Minimum of 3 years of golf sales experience.
    • Active experience playing golf, with a strong understanding of clubs, specifications, shaft profiles, ball flight characteristics, and technology used in modern equipment.
    • Ability to work a flexible schedule based on business needs, including weekends.

    Part-Time Benefits:

    • 401k company match
    • Employee Programs such as PGA membership dues support
    • Paid Time Off
    • Discounted Merchandise
    • Health and Wellness Initiatives
    • Work Life Balance

      Job types: Part-time, seasonal.

      Compensation:

      $25-$35 per hour, based on experienceÂ
